Recommended installation flow
Install, configure, preview, go live
The recommended way to start with Kea Search Pro lets AI handle the work while Preview keeps the decision with you. Nothing reaches shoppers until you approve it.
- 01 Start with your AI Add the Kea Search Pro skills to a supported AI client and connect it to the store you want to configure.
- 02 Install and configure Let the AI install Kea Search Pro, inspect the catalog, and configure search, categories, facets, synonyms, and merchandising.
- 03 Review in Preview Check the complete search experience, responsive layouts, filters, product cards, and supported store actions before anything goes live.
- 04 Approve and go live Publish only when you are satisfied, then let the workflow verify the live storefront again on desktop and mobile.

Search setup with AI
Let AI configure search and merchandising for your catalog
Your AI starts with the store's catalog, language, searchable fields, categories, and existing rules. It uses Kea Search Pro skills and authorized MCP tools to prepare settings that fit the store instead of applying the same generic configuration everywhere.
- Choose searchable product fields and their relevance priorities.
- Configure categories, storefront facets, and synonyms.
- Set category priorities and merchandising rules around the store's goals.
- Use search analytics when the store has enough shopper activity.
- Keep deliberate manual settings instead of replacing them with generic output.
Preview before launch
Keep the live store unchanged until you are ready
Preview is the recommended default. Your AI prepares and checks the candidate on desktop and mobile while the live storefront stays unchanged. When you are satisfied, you approve publication and the workflow checks the live storefront again.
- Keep the live storefront unchanged while the AI prepares the candidate.
- Review product images, links, filters, cards, and supported product actions.
- Publish only after an explicit approval.
- Use built-in self-diagnostics and preserve the native storefront if production verification fails.
Storefront customization with AI
Let AI adapt the search interface and product templates to your store
The workflow examines the store's current theme before changing the search interface. It adapts supported layouts, colors, responsive columns, and product-card templates so search feels like part of the existing storefront.
- Configure the search widget, classic results page, or a combined experience.
- Adapt desktop and mobile grids, filters, layouts, and product-card templates.
- Preserve supported add-to-cart, quantity, Wishlist, Quick View, price, and badge behavior from the theme.
- Keep the candidate in Preview when the source structure cannot be adapted and checked safely.

Can I use ChatGPT, Claude Code, or Codex to install Kea Search Pro?
Yes, when the selected client supports the required MCP connection and store workflow. You use your own AI client and model account. Kea Labs provides the Kea Search Pro skills, controlled Search Pro tools, workflow, and compatibility guidance.
Can the AI install and set up Kea Search Pro from scratch?
Yes. The complete workflow can start with a fresh PrestaShop store, install Kea Search Pro, provision dedicated Search Pro access, inspect the catalog, configure search, adapt the interface, build Preview output, publish when instructed, and verify production.
What can the AI configure in search?
The supported workflow covers searchable fields, relevance priorities, categories, merchandising rules, category priorities, synonyms, storefront facets, search analytics, and the checks required before applying a change.
Can the AI customize the search interface to match the store theme?
Yes, for a supported theme structure. The workflow inspects a real category page and adapts layouts, responsive columns, colors, product-card templates, and observed native product actions. Hummingbird and Classic have independent acceptance evidence.
Can I review everything before it goes live?
Yes. UI work defaults to Preview and is checked on desktop and mobile. Publication requires an explicit instruction, uses the normal release-candidate pipeline, and is followed by a fresh production storefront verification.
